
VICAR OF DIBLEY, THE: LOVE AND MARRIAGE {SECOND SERIES FINALE} (TV)
Summary
One in this series of situation comedies about the first female vicar of Dibley, a country village full of daffy folk. In this episode, Alice Tinker and Hugo Horton are to be married, and Vicar Geraldine Granger considers doing missionary work in Liverpool. Geraldine is caught in the middle of the wedding planning. On one hand, she listens to Alice's wacky plans which include a knitted wedding gown with a linoleum train. On the other hand, she also tries to comply with David Horton's requests for a tasteful ceremony to please his guests. To complicate matters, David's brother Simon comes for the wedding a few days early and Geraldine finds herself wildly attracted to him. However, in spite of several misshaps and mix-ups, everything comes together for the wedding, which proves to be a happy compromise between Alice and David's tastes. At the reception, Geraldine is unsure of whether or not to move on to work in Liverpool, but several factors draw her back to Dibley.
(This program is the winner of the 1998 International Emmy Award for popular arts.)
